Features:
  • Image resolution up to 2816 x 2112 with 4x digital zoom
  • Specifically designed for divers to take brighter, colorful pictures underwater up to 30'
  • Records movies up to 320 x 240 at 24fps
  • Uses 2 AA alkaline or NiMH batteries and SD memory up to 1GB
  • Includes 2 AA alkaline batteries, hand strap, USB cable and software

I'm really happy with the purchase of the Vivitar 6200W. I took the camera to Maui and the photos came out much better than the disposable underwater cameras. We went snorkeling 3 times with the camera and its holding up well. The feature I like the best about the camera is taking underwater videos with sound. The shutter speed of the camera is a bit slow (takes 2-3 seconds between each shot) but the photo quality is very good in daylight conditions. We weren't as impressed with the early morning snorkeling photos since it doesn't do so well in low light conditions. But overall, its the a great underwater digital camera under $200.

Pros:
- Video mode with sound (which also works well underwater)
- Photo quality in daylight situations is very good
- Case is well designed (2 latches to keep the battery/SD card compartment dry - it shouldn't have any problems while snorkeling as long as the rubber seal is ok)
- Low price
- Decent battery life, it'll last a 1-2 hour snorkel trip on AAs
- Case included
- SD card slot (I recommend buying at least a 1GB SD card)

Cons:
- The picture does not display after you snap a photo (it just shows a blank screen after you take a photo)
- No zoom (digital zoom is available but not recommended)
- Low light performance is ok, could be better

I tried out in a pool our Vivitar 6200W Digital Camera. The camera took very good photos out of the water and under the water. Also the underwater movie mode did great! The sound works best underwater for the movie mode. Out of the water the movie sound has an echo but you can still understand what is being said. I bought rechargeable AA batteries that lasted for over 250 photos before needing to be recharged. The camera view finder works well out of the water but in the water is very hard to see. Also very bright sunlight makes the view finder hard to see at times.

i ordered this camera for a trip to cuba that i just got back from. the underwater pictures i took snorkeling and on a shallow scuba dive turned out great - especially after i used the enclosed software to filter out a lot of the overall greenishness. takes very nice pics on land as well - they don't look great on the screen on the camera, but when you download them to the computer, they look much better. i think i actually had it a little deeper than 30 feet on the dive and it worked fine. only drawback is that it is a battery PIG, especially underwater, so take lots of AA's , dry the camera off between dives and change them even if they're not dead yet, 'cause they will be soon! so far, i am very happy that i bought this camera!
